From 09e2594fce27c779e4488e66529082fdb7700b64 Mon Sep 17 00:00:00 2001 From: Mat Booth Date: Jun 17 2015 16:29:03 +0000 Subject: Fix FTBFS by disabling javadoc linting --- diff --git a/java-gnome-doclint.patch b/java-gnome-doclint.patch new file mode 100644 index 0000000..6b3c486 --- /dev/null +++ b/java-gnome-doclint.patch @@ -0,0 +1,10 @@ +--- build/faster.orig 2015-06-17 17:19:52.029950813 +0100 ++++ build/faster 2015-06-17 17:20:23.052582233 +0100 +@@ -648,6 +648,7 @@ + cmd += "-quiet " + + cmd += "-d doc/api " ++ cmd += "-Xdoclint:none " + cmd += "-public " + cmd += "-nodeprecated " + cmd += "-source 1.5 " diff --git a/java-gnome.spec b/java-gnome.spec index 0917b27..38eeb14 100644 --- a/java-gnome.spec +++ b/java-gnome.spec @@ -1,11 +1,13 @@ Summary: Java GNOME bindings Name: java-gnome Version: 4.1.3 -Release: 7%{?dist} +Release: 8%{?dist} URL: http://java-gnome.sourceforge.net Source0: http://ftp.gnome.org/pub/gnome/sources/java-gnome/4.1/java-gnome-%{version}.tar.xz # Workaround for brp-java-repack-jars skipping top-level dot-files Patch0: java-gnome-4.1.3-libdir.patch +# Disable strict java 8 doclint +Patch1: java-gnome-doclint.patch # This is the "Classpath" exception. License: GPLv2 with exceptions Group: System Environment/Libraries @@ -55,6 +57,7 @@ design documentation and sample code. %prep %setup -q %patch0 -p1 +%patch1 # Remove all binaries find . -name "*.jar" -exec rm -f {} \; @@ -102,6 +105,9 @@ rm -rf $(readlink -f %{_javadocdir}/%{name}) %{_javadocdir}/%{name} || : %{_javadocdir}/%{name} %changelog +* Wed Jun 17 2015 Mat Booth - 4.1.3-8 +- Fix FTBFS by disabling javadoc linting + * Wed Jun 17 2015 Fedora Release Engineering - 4.1.3-7 - Rebuilt for https://fedoraproject.org/wiki/Fedora_23_Mass_Rebuild